Output 66be063afad831158075468fe13dbb7014a20b9c9366c5cdb121d475084edcf6:39

value
95246
script pubkey
OP_0 OP_PUSHBYTES_20 58ab67ee52aa3352c9c6b54a9286c6e126c11329
address
bc1qtz4k0mjj4ge49jwxk49f9pkxuynvzyefmutjky
transaction
66be063afad831158075468fe13dbb7014a20b9c9366c5cdb121d475084edcf6
spent
true